About Our Client


Our client is a global manufacturer with strong operations across Asia. The Thailand site is growing and requires a strong Finance & Accounting Manager to support operational excellence and longterm business performance.

Job Description

  • Lead financial planning, budgeting, forecasting, and costcontrol initiatives for the Thailand entity.
  • Drive financial strategies aligned with business goals and provide insights to guide management decisions.
  • Oversee preparation of timely and accurate financial statements including P&L, Balance Sheet, and Cash Flow.
  • Monitor financial performance and produce variance analysis for functional leaders.
  • Ensure full compliance with Thai GAAP, tax laws, and international standards such as IFRS.
  • Manage corporate tax, VAT, withholding tax, and ensure all statutory filings are accurate and submitted on time.
  • Maintain strong internal controls, risk management practices, and compliance with company policies.
  • Support internal and external audits and act as key liaison to auditors and tax authorities.
  • Lead and develop a team of two finance professionals, driving capability and performance.
  • Manage cash flow, working capital, and treasury operations to safeguard assets and ensure financial stability.
  • Collaborate with crossfunctional teams (Operations, Supply Chain, Quality, HR) to support business priorities.
  • Ensure accurate SAP master data and coordinate with global and regional finance teams.
  • Work closely with local service partners and external platforms to fulfill financial obligations.
  • Uphold high standards in Quality, Safety, and Environmental compliance as part of daily responsibilities.

The Successful Applicant


  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ting or Finance; Master's degree or CPA is an advantage.
  • Minimum 7 years of relevant experience in accounting or finance, ideally in a manufacturing or multinational environment.
  • Strong knowledge of GAAP, Thai accounting standards, and tax regulations.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office and SAP or similar systems.
  • Strong communication skills in Thai and English, with the ability to collaborate across functions and manage deadlines under pressure.
